Differences between Mini Cloud Computers and Traditional Mini Computers

2025 02/20

With the increasing maturity of cloud computing technology, cloud mini computer have emerged as a new favorite in the field of technology.
Its core principle is to virtualize the hardware resources of a computer, enabling it to run efficiently on cloud servers and transmit the computing results to users' terminal devices in real time through the network. This means that users no longer need to rely on high-performance local hardware. With just a simple terminal device and a stable network connection, they can enjoy powerful computer functions.
Today, we will explain the differences between cloud computers and traditional computers.
 
Key Differences
1. Hardware Infrastructure
  • Traditional PC: Relies on local hardware (CPU, memory, storage).
  • Cloud PC: Leverages centralized, virtualized resources on remote cloud servers.
2. Performance
  • Flexibility: Cloud PCs dynamically scale resources for demanding tasks like big data processing, while traditional PCs are limited by fixed local hardware.
  • Latency: Cloud PCs may experience delays due to network constraints, whereas traditional PCs operate without latency concerns.
3. Maintenance & Management
  • User Responsibility: Traditional PCs require manual software updates, hardware upgrades, and data backups.
  • Provider-Managed: Cloud PC infrastructure, security, and updates are handled by service providers.
4. Cost Structure
  • Upfront Investment: Traditional Mini Desktop Computer demand significant initial hardware costs.
  • Pay-as-You-Go: Cloud Mini PC operate on subscription or usage-based models, reducing entry barriers.
5. Portability & Accessibility
  • Cloud PCs: Accessible from any device with internet connectivity, ideal for remote work and mobility.
  • Traditional PCs: Less portable, especially desktop models.
6. Data Security
  • Local Storage: Traditional PCs store data on-device, requiring user-managed security.
  • Cloud Storage: Cloud PCs encrypt data and enforce strict access controls, backed by professional security teams.
7. Use Cases
  • Traditional PCs: Suited for everyday tasks like office work and entertainment.
  • Cloud PCs: Optimized for high-performance computing, data analysis, and mobile workflows.
